#23bfc0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23bfc0 is composed of 13.7% red, 74.9%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.8%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 180.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 44.5%. #23bfc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#007f81.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#23bfc0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020909 is the darkest color, while #f8f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#23bfc0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#697a7a is the less saturated color, while #00e1e3 is the most saturated one.
